2 Remain in $240 Mil. Shell Review

NEW YORK Following presentations last week as part of a global media consolidation, Shell said it has cut to two finalists: Interpublic Group’s Initiative and an entity called Shell Team Media, which combines the efforts of WPP’s Maxus and Grey Global Group’s MediaCom. (WPP is in the process of acquiring Grey Global).

Estimated billings are $240 million.

Maxus and MediaCom started the process with separate pitches.

Cut from the review were Publicis Groupe’s Starcom MediaVest and Aegis Group’s Carat.
